Quantum search by partial adiabatic evolution
Abstract
A quantum search algorithm based on the partial adiabatic evolutionTulsi2009 is provided. We calculate its time complexity by studying the Hamiltonian in a two-dimensional Hilbert space. It is found that the algorithm improves the time complexity, which is O(N/M), of the local adiabatic search algorithmRoland2002, to O(N/M).
